## Narrative

Employee heard a noise coming from refuse screen. Put hand between springs and side panel causing abrasions to right wrist and hand. Amputation of right middle finger and fingernail requiring skin grafts. Strain to back occurred as employee pulled hand back from machine.  Delay in reporting due to waiting on medical reports.  MEDICAL TREATMENT ONLY.  NO LOST TIME.
